Transaction 668b4be56841c96fa3d13a1d107db98b981d2f792b6a88dc8b951aa91f01167f

1 Input
2 Outputs
  • 668b4be56841c96fa3d13a1d107db98b981d2f792b6a88dc8b951aa91f01167f:0
  • value  29542000
    address  1uLB86hTiqb1Dz3WS2hstPdWNxMtNoraw
  • 668b4be56841c96fa3d13a1d107db98b981d2f792b6a88dc8b951aa91f01167f:1
  • value  39510229
    address  15cGVMcreuuAMuwEACTKmEGvVY5eePiwsw